Which of the following is the correct formula for cesium sulfide?A.CsS2B.CsSC.Cs2S2D.Cs2S

The correct formula for cesium sulfide is D. Cs2S.

Here's the step-by-step explanation:

  1. Cesium (Cs) is in group 1 of the periodic table, so it has a +1 charge.
  2. Sulfur (S) is in group 16 of the periodic table, so it has a -2 charge.
  3. When forming a compound, the total charge should be neutral. Therefore, we need two Cs+ ions to balance one S2- ion.
  4. Hence, the formula is Cs2S.
